Kawaii Star Nails ^.^
This manicure turned out looking like something a girl from Japan would wear... So that's why I named this Kawaii Star Nails ^.^!
I love the Essie polish I used as my base, turquoise & caicos. It needs three coats though (without nail art on top of it might even need four), but the colour makes up for it. I stamped stars on the top and finished my nails with MAX 'daimond sky' (I'm not spelling this wrong, it says 'daimond' on the bottle).
